I came here with three other people to try out this new-to-us restaurant. The space was smaller than expected with a few tables and a kitchen you can sort of see from most tables. The menu has a lot of variety of rolls, sashimi, and some ramen options. Our table shared a Philly roll and ma-se bite (pressed spicy tuna on rice). The sushi was delicious and felt like great quality. It is their specialty after all. A couple people got tonkotsu ramen with pork belly and enjoyed it. They said their broth was rich and tasty with nice noodles. I ordered the shoyu ramen which listed ground chicken but I was served sliced chicken breast. The broth wasn't salty like I expected and was instead on the sweeter side. I added chili oil to it which I think just made it into a spicy water instead. The chicken pieces were not something I want again. The texture was so strange and almost fatty feeling if that's possible. I would try something else next time.

Wow. We really wanted to like this place. We came in with high, high hopes!! We ordered the Cucumber with Kimchi sauce, Miso Citrus Wings, TomKha Ramen and Spicy Mala Ramen. We enjoyed the apps. The cucumbers were crisp and refreshing. You couldn't even taste the kimchi nor was there any heat to it. The Miso Citrus Wings were packed with flavor and spice. The smell opens up your airway but this top didn't have heat. It was served very hot but not spicy at all. The TomKha Ramen was good the first few bites in, but then just like the black garlic Ramen, the taste became too rich and my stomach was not liking it. I also don't recommend adding chicken. I don't know what it was but for me, it made the flavor worse. It was odd because I love Tom Kha soup which is why I ventured to try this particular ramen. I will give it another shot but with no protein. My husband said the Spicy Mala Ramen was good but had an after taste due to the black peppercorn. That after taste kind of liked it for him. Service was really slow but so was the restaurant. It took awhile for our ramens to come out. We were completely done with our apps for at least 15 mins. We had to ask for water refills even though they had been sitting almost empty through half of our meal. And the food was a bit on the pricey side for what we got. Not sure if we'd come again but being as there isn't much ramen places in this area we may...

We stopped into Pisco after a long drive from North Carolina, looking for something quick and…read morelocal. We've been a few times before, and the food has always been great. This visit was no exception -- the food was genuinely excellent. That said, the business model is starting to feel aggressive. Every interaction is an upsell opportunity, and you quickly realize you're on high alert the entire meal, almost battling the server at every turn just to avoid quietly running up the bill. It starts the moment you sit down: "Is bottled water okay?" -- which, of course, is an upcharge. When we ordered Pisco Sours, instead of just bringing the standard version, the server recommended the Peruvian one, about $5 more. For starters, my wife wanted a chicken dish, but the server suggested a beef dish, mentioning it could be made with chicken instead. The catch: there was no price reduction for swapping to chicken, leaving us paying $12 more than the original chicken dish would have cost. I had the Lomo Saltado, which was fantastic, and asked for fries instead of the yellow potatoes. I don't mind an upcharge -- but it would have been nice to be told upfront. A simple "there's a small upcharge for that" would have been fine. They also take photos of you at the table, which is pleasant enough on its own, but by then you're conditioned to wonder what it's going to cost. When the check arrived, an 18% gratuity had already been added, with the option to tip more on top. We declined to add extra. The food really is excellent, and we may go back for that reason alone. But be prepared to stay on your toes -- every choice seems designed to nudge the bill higher, and you'll spend the meal defending your wallet rather than relaxing into it.
